pub enum ColorKind {
LinearGradient(LinearGradient),
RadialGradient(RadialGradient),
ConicalGradient(ConicalGradient),
SolidColor(SolidColor),
}Expand description
An enum to describe the possible kinds of colors used when rendering various
Layer attributes/properties.
Variants§
LinearGradient(LinearGradient)
A kind of LinearGradient.
RadialGradient(RadialGradient)
A kind of RadialGradient.
ConicalGradient(ConicalGradient)
A kind of ConicalGradient.
SolidColor(SolidColor)
A kind of SolidColor.
